The Function of UTM Parameters in Efficiency Marketing
Performance advertising and marketing intends to drive measurable company results. UTM criteria collaborate with analytics devices to provide a clearer photo of project performance.
Constant tagging makes it possible for accurate tracking and permits comparison of data. Inconsistent tagging, on the other hand, can bring about duplicated sessions or improperly connected conversions. To stay clear of these issues, execute a consistent identifying convention and routinely audit web links to recognize and deal with discrepancies.
1. Tracking Web traffic
Utilizing UTM criteria within your electronic marketing efforts enables you to get beneficial insights on what is driving traffic and conversions. When utilized properly, this information can aid you identify the exact channels and projects that are reaching your suitable consumers with relevant messaging so they convert quicker.
There are 3 major UTM tags that marketers generally utilize: resource, tool, and project. Including these tags to web links can aid you sort incoming traffic into quickly digestible reports in your analytics devices. It is very important to bear in mind that when it comes to tagging URLs, consistency is essential. Blending conventions can cause irregular monitoring and manipulated cause your coverage. Stay clear of making use of spelling in your tagging and try to keep the parameters short, meaningful, and clean.
2. Attribution
Comprehensive attribution data allows online marketers to identify high-performing channels and shift budgets accordingly. It also enables teams to create and test new marketing strategies from an unified analytics report, such as using gated content with cool emailing projects to bring in high-value leads earlier.
UTM criteria are crucial for granular acknowledgment coverage. They can consist of several identifiers, consisting of the project name and medium utilized to track web traffic. They can also include a term, which can be used to by hand recognize paid key phrases for pay per click projects, and material, which can be utilized to distinguish different variations of the very same item of advertising material for A/B testing.
Adding these identifiers to web links can be a little taxing, however it's worth the couple of seconds to ensure you're obtaining exact, informative analytics reports from your digital marketing initiatives. Irregular or uncertain specifications can result in misleading data, so it is necessary to develop clear calling conventions and stick to them across the team.

Using UTM parameters is straightforward, and there are tools to help marketing experts develop and use them. It is important to be consistent when calling specifications to avoid complication and make sure all advertising teams get on the very same web page. Maintaining a shared spreadsheet for server-side tracking monitoring and sharing links can aid to maintain everyone straightened.
A few of the most valuable naming conventions include utm_source, utm_medium, and utm_campaign. The utm_source and utm_medium are needed for analytics reporting, while the utm_campaign is used to recognize a certain product promo or general marketing project.
4. Cross-Channel Advertising
Using UTM criteria properly helps marketing experts track off-site and on-site advertising projects, revealing traffic resources in their analytics tool. This provides useful insights that can bring about much better campaign preparation and budget appropriation.
For instance, if you're running multiple projects to drive new customers to your web site, you can label any kind of social media sites blog posts or electronic advertising relate to a utm_campaign code like "bfcm". When you look at the Purchase - Source/Medium report in Google Analytics, this will certainly aid you determine the details network that drove traffic and conversions to your website.
Similarly, you can utilize utm_content tags to construct and track gated material like whitepapers or e-books. These identified links give intent data, permitting marketers to get to high-value leads and enhance their opportunities of conversion.
